As I wrote earlier, I'm not an expert on this, and a quick web search
didn't turn up anything definitive.  The search did show that the
isotope data have been disputed going back at least as far as 2012.
It's also important to remember that there are other kinds of data
including elemental composition of both bodies.

In article <rLOdnXy-3tZHZjLLnZ2dnUU7-fGdnZ2d@giganews.com>,
 Yousuf Khan <bbbl67@spammenot.yahoo.com> writes:
> Other ones that would still be viable are the Fission hypothesis, where 
> the Moon was once a part of the Earth, but due to an imbalance it 
> pinched itself off of the Earth. This would certainly maintain identical 
> isotope levels between the Earth and Moon.

If the early Earth was spinning fast enough to cause it to fission,
how could it ever have formed in the first place?  For this
hypothesis to be viable, someone would have to produce a real
calculation.

> Another one is the Condensation Hypothesis, which suggested that the 
> Earth and Moon formed from the same section of the original solar system 
> nebula. So basically the two worlds evolved together as a twin planet 
> system. This would also pretty much maintain identical isotope levels.

Also identical element composition, it would seem.  Isn't the Moon
much-depleted in iron?  That's a natural consequence of the impact
hypothesis but seems hard to explain if two bodies formed near each
other.

I don't think the full answer is known yet, but the impact hypothesis
has a lot to like.
